Ensuring access to clean water and sanitation for displaced families in CAR
To ensure access to clean water and sanitation for families not only affected by conflict but also increasingly vulnerable during COVID-19, World Vision is installing facilities in an "integrated village" in Pladama Ouaka through funding from Aktion Deutschland Hilft. During a visit to the Central African Republic (CAR) from 27 February to 5 March 2022, our Chief Field Operations Officer and West Africa Regional Leader visited some of the newly installed WASH facilities to witness the impact, and celebrate achievements.

Zambia’s Vice President commends World Vision for TBZ Water Project that has connected over 1,000 people to clean water
The Vice President of the Republic of Zambia, Her Honour, Mrs. W.K Mutale – Nalumamgo, MP, has praised World Vision Zambia for providing safe and clean drinking water through a piped water scheme that will reach over 1,000 thousand households of the TBZ community in Nkeyema district of Western Province.
Mrs. Nalumango was speaking during the handover of the Nkeyema Mechanisation water system funded by Golf Fore Africa and implemented by World Vision Zambia in partnership with Western Water and Sanitation Company and the government of Zambia through the Ministry of Water Development and Sanitation.

World Vision Kenya Annual Report 2023
This Report covers the work and impact of World Vision Kenya from October 1st, 2022 to September 30th, 2023. In the period, our transformative projects reached over three million people (1,934,341 children & 1,495, 512 adults) showcasing our impactful efforts in transforming the lives of vulnerable children and communities across Kenya.
